How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Associate Wealth Manager - Pathway to Advice
    Location: London
    Salary: £29,000 - £33,000 (dependent on exams) + bonus

    An established and fast-growing wealth management firm is looking to hire an Associate Wealth Manager to join their London team.

    This is a business that has seen strong growth over the past few years, now managing over £1bn in client assets, while maintaining a genuinely collaborative and supportive culture.
     
    The Opportunity

    This is a structured role designed for someone looking to accelerate their progression toward becoming a Chartered Financial Planner.

    You'll work closely with an experienced Wealth Manager and their team, gaining hands-on exposure to client work while continuing your exams and development through a well-supported training programme (expected 12-18 months)

    It's a strong fit for someone who enjoys both the technical side of planning and building toward a client-facing advisory role.
     
    To start you off, you will be:

    Attending client meetings alongside Wealth Managers
    Managing follow-up actions and ongoing client servicing
    Supporting with technical calculations (pensions, allowances, etc.)
    Investment research and analysis
    Preparing cashflow models and planning reports
    Handling client queries (technical and administrative)
    Identifying opportunities within existing client relationships
    Managing workflow through internal systems and trackers  
    About You

    Experience within a wealth management / financial planning environment
    Minimum of 2 RO exams (or equivalent)
    Strong attention to detail and organisational skills
    Confident communicator with a professional approach
    Motivated, proactive, and keen to progress into an advisory role  
     
    Why This Role

    Clear pathway to becoming a Chartered Financial Planner
    Exposure to high-quality clients and experienced advisers
    Strong internal support and training structure
    A collaborative, social, and high-performing team environment
